Output 62f89a04bf29a7f144abc9318a8210960cf0928c9a044e9cbb0538971d1ec6d0:12

value
81000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ae161361afc60ddc45739861b2912304b51fe1b9 OP_EQUAL
address
3HZVwmaaxrJ8wbCC7F5Ga7UqQoznrnzPDc
transaction
62f89a04bf29a7f144abc9318a8210960cf0928c9a044e9cbb0538971d1ec6d0
spent
true